Bio-Link is a biotechnology commercialisation company that works with local and international academic institutions and biotech companies to facilitate deals based on strategic technology analysis, project management, business development and deal negotiation. The team works at the interface of research and business and draws on a deep well of experience in diagnostics, immunotherapeutics, small molecule drug development and other areas of biotechnology.

Bio-Link News

TGR-212 tissue regeneration technology for combination with biomaterials and regenerative templates from Bio-Link
10.01.2010 - TGR Biosciences and Bio-Link present TGR-212; a bioactive molecule for combination withbiomaterials designed for wound care and regenerative therapy.
Q8009 pro-coagulant for surgery and wound management from Bio-Link
09.01.2010 - QRxPharma Ltd. and Bio-Link present a novel preclinical candidate protein, Q8009, for the control of blood loss through topical wound management and surgical sealant applications.
Bio-Link introduces Dynamin inhibitors for cancer
08.01.2010 - Researchers at Bio-Link have shown that inhibition of the activity of the GTPase Dynamin can prevent cytokinesis, leading to cell death in cancer cells.
MyoGel Novel Human Adipogenic cell matrix from Bio-Link
07.01.2010 - MyoGel, manufactured by Bio-Link, is a novel muscle-derived biomaterial which is composed of a mixture of cytokines, growth factors and extracellular matrix protein constituents.
